Job DescriptionThe Mechanical Engineer focuses on the design and engineering of HVAC and mechanical utilities for new buildings, renovations/additions and processes. The individual possesses demonstrated ability to manage multiple complex tasks, establish priorities and direct the work of others. This position is responsible for overseeing the Mechanical discipline scope of work and managing the discipline budget on small to medium projects of intermediate complexity, and coordinating with internal and external architects and engineers, as well as clients, construction managers, subcontractors, vendors and manufacturers. Typical tasks and deliverables include load calculations, utility assessments, energy modeling, design reports, code evaluations, plans, P&IDs, schedules, installation details, equipment and system selection and specification, and coordination with manufacturers and trade partners. Tasks will include utilizing software for building information modeling, computer-aided drafting and engineering calculations. Project work involves directing design activities for all levels of design such as studies, conceptual and schematic design, design development, construction documentation and construction administration.
